2017-02-06 12 views
1

js 2.0と私はダイナミックな小道具で在庫されています。Vue.js 2.0動的小道具ドキュメント

参照イメージはこのように私のHTMLコード

enter image description here

を添付

:私はどのようにデータが関数であることを知っているが、

Vue.component('child', { 

    props: ['myMessage'], 
    template: '<p>{{ myMessage }}</p>', 

}) 

var app = new Vue({ 

    el: "#app", 


}); 

<div id="app"> 
    <div> 
     <input v-model="parentMsg"> 
     <br> 
     <child v-bind:my-message="parentMsg"></child> 
    </div> 
</div> 

私のコンポーネント・コード私はそれを実装するつもりです。コンソールでこのエラーが発生します。

プロパティまたはメソッド「parentMsgは」インスタンスで定義されているが参照されていない間、私はメッセージは明確だと思う

答えて

3

をレンダリングします。 "parentMsg" is not defined on the instance。親レベルでparentMsgを定義する必要があります。

var app = new Vue({ 
    data: { 
     "parentMsg": "" 
    } 
    el: "#app" 
}); 

あなたは実際のフィドルhereを持つことができます。

関連する問題